HIT Certification Committee to Develop ACO IT Framework

The Certification Commission for Health Information Technology has announced plans to develop a framework for IT infrastructure needed to start and operate an effective accountable care organization.

Advertisement

The framework will also help identify gaps in an ACO’s IT infrastructure that could prevent the organization from meeting its goals.

CCHIT plans to publish the framework so organizations across the country can learn from it as they develop ACOs.

Once developed, the framework may serve as the basis of a CCHIT certification program for ACOs.
